Output fb91e5ee25679a249c982509bbaf02bc005f64aeac514d97adc00dbe5025974f:69

value
43808
script pubkey
OP_0 OP_PUSHBYTES_32 2a76996508da3794541f4307e8d1a27189844a58fac63a48689823d49ec8c904
address
bc1q9fmfjeggmgmeg4qlgvr735dzwxycgjjcltrr5jrgnq3af8kgeyzqs4ht66
transaction
fb91e5ee25679a249c982509bbaf02bc005f64aeac514d97adc00dbe5025974f
confirmations
125895
spent
true